Addlestone station offers essential ticket buying and collection services, including smartcards issued right at the station. Although the ticket office is open only for limited hours during weekdays and Saturdays, ticket machines are available for all-day use, making the ticket purchasing process a breeze. South Western Railway ticket machines even accommodate Disabled Persons Railcard discounts, ensuring accessibility for all.
However, the station lacks in some facilities, such as refreshment outlets, ATMs, and shops, which means it's wise to plan ahead if you require these amenities. The absence of seating and 1st class lounges may be a downside, but the station compensates with heated waiting areas that are code-compliant situated within the limited-hours ticket office. For those needing help regarding their journey, though staff assistance is not directly available, travelers can rely on customer service help points or reach out to the Customer Service Centre, giving a sense of security and support during travel.
Step-free access enhances inclusivity at Addlestone with Category B1 access allowing smooth transitions to both platforms. Although ticket barriers aren't present, the station provides accessible ticket machines and ramps to facilitate rail travel for everyone. However, there is room for improvement, as facilities such as accessible toilets, trained staff assistance, and mobility aids like wheelchairs, are absent.
Addlestone station is seamlessly connected to various transport links. If trains face interruptions, rail replacement services to Weybridge, Woking, and Virginia Water offer alternatives. Convenient bus services make transitioning from rail to road effortless, with detailed information accessible online for further planning.

Long Buckby train station, while compact, is equipped with a variety of important features to ensure a smooth travel experience. The station opens its ticket office from Monday to Friday between 06:15 and 11:00, the perfect window for an early start to your day. Getting tickets is incredibly convenient with ticket machines available for use. However, there's no provision for accessible ticket machines, so plan accordingly if you need assistance.
Safety measures include the presence of an induction loop, very useful for passengers with hearing impairments. Although, there is no CCTV surveillance at the station, so ensure your belongings are always in sight. For those who need assistance, staff are available during ticket office hours, and there's an assistance meeting point by the ticket office.
When it comes to onward travel, Long Buckby provides seamless connectivity options. For those traveling by air, you can reach Birmingham International Airport easily from the station. If your journey involves bus services, consider planning with information available from national rail posters, which can be printed for convenience.
In times of rail service disruptions, worry not, as replacement services operate from the station’s car park entrance on Station Road. It's always good to check your destination before boarding these services.
